The Role Of Hydration In Anti-Aging

Hydration influences how skin responds to environmental stress, maintains barrier function, and manages visible signs of aging. Without adequate moisture retention, skin becomes vulnerable to irritation, compromised healing, and surface degradation that amplifies fine lines and texture irregularities.

 

Why Moisture Matters For Aging Skin

As skin ages, moisture retention declines due to reduced lipid production, slower cell turnover, and environmental exposure. Fine lines become more visible, elasticity decreases, and texture turns dull and uneven. When dehydration compromises the barrier, inflammatory responses increase, and sensitivity to active ingredients rises, undermining your entire routine.

 

How Hyaluronic Acid Delivers And Maintains Hydration

Hyaluronic acid draws water into the epidermis from the environment and deeper skin layers. Low-weight molecules reach deeper layers while high-weight molecules form a moisture-retaining surface film, collectively reducing transepidermal water loss.

 

Limitations Of Hydration-Only Approaches

Hyaluronic acid won't stimulate collagen production, accelerate cellular turnover, or reverse sun damage. Deeper wrinkles and structural volume loss require ingredients that work at the cellular level to rebuild collagen networks and correct photoaging damage.

 

Combining Hydration With Active Repair

The most effective anti-aging strategies integrate both hydration and cellular repair. Properly hydrated skin tolerates retinoids better, experiences fewer side effects, and maintains barrier integrity throughout the adjustment period.

Understanding Retinol's Mechanism For Collagen Support

Retinol works at the cellular level to reverse structural aging by activating genetic pathways that increase collagen production, accelerate cell turnover, and repair photoaging damage. Unlike hydration-focused ingredients, retinol penetrates deeper to create lasting changes in skin architecture.

 

How Retinol Stimulates Cellular Turnover

Retinol is converted to retinoic acid within skin cells, where it binds to nuclear receptors that regulate gene expression. This accelerates new cell production and speeds migration to the surface, replacing damaged cells with healthier tissue, improving texture, reducing hyperpigmentation, and increasing responsiveness to other treatments. Retinol's Effect On Collagen Production

Retinol stimulates fibroblasts to produce new collagen and elastin while inhibiting enzymes that break down existing networks, rebuilding dermal density, and reducing wrinkle depth. Visible results require 8 to 12 weeks of consistent use, representing genuine structural repair rather than temporary surface effects.

 

Managing Retinol Sensitivity And Adjustment Periods

Initial use often triggers temporary dryness or peeling lasting 2 to 4 weeks. A gradual introduction at lower concentrations effectively manages this, and pairing retinol with hyaluronic acid minimizes irritation while maintaining barrier function. Retinol Strength Levels And What To Expect

A retinol cream for the face ranges in concentration from 0.25% for sensitive skin to 1% for established tolerance. Encapsulated formulations reduce irritation while maintaining efficacy, and combining retinol with actives like bakuchiol improves comfort across different skin types.

 

Layering Hyaluronic Acid And Retinol Effectively

Proper layering maximizes the benefits of both ingredients while minimizing irritation and barrier disruption. Understanding application order, timing, and formulation compatibility ensures optimal hydration support during active cellular renewal.

 

Timing And Application Strategies

Apply hyaluronic acid to damp skin immediately after cleansing. Wait until the skin is completely dry before applying retinol, as damp skin increases penetration and can trigger unnecessary irritation. A retinol night serum works best after hyaluronic acid has absorbed but before heavier moisturizers.

 

Minimizing Irritation When Combining Both

Start with lower concentrations and begin with twice-weekly application, progressing to every other night. If irritation occurs, sandwich a retinol night cream between two moisturizer layers: apply hyaluronic acid, then a light moisturizer, followed by retinol, then seal with additional moisturizer.

 

Frequency And Progressive Dosing

Consistency matters more than concentration. Regular lower-dose application produces better long-term results than sporadic higher-concentration use. Mild dryness is expected during adjustment, but persistent redness or barrier compromise indicates excessive application requiring reduced frequency.

 

Product Formulation Matters For Compatibility

Avoid combining retinol with high concentrations of vitamin C, benzoyl peroxide, or strong acids. Look for retinol products containing ceramides, niacinamide, or peptides to enhance tolerability while maintaining efficacy.

Timeline Expectations: When You'll See Results

Understanding realistic timelines prevents premature abandonment of effective routines. Hyaluronic acid and retinol work on different schedules, with results appearing at distinct intervals based on their mechanisms of action.

 

Hyaluronic Acid Results And Sustainability

Hyaluronic acid provides visible hydration and plumping within hours, peaking at 24 hours, and requires daily reapplication to maintain results. Consistent use over weeks improves barrier function and moisture retention, creating a more resilient foundation for active treatments.

 

Retinol Results And The Adjustment Window

Improved texture and clarity become noticeable after 4 to 6 weeks. Deeper changes, including collagen improvement and wrinkle reduction, require 12 to 16 weeks as new collagen networks form. The first 2 to 4 weeks may temporarily worsen the appearance before visible improvement emerges.

 

Long-Term Benefits Of Consistent Dual Use

After six months of using the best anti-aging serum combination for your skin, expect measurable improvement in fine lines, texture evenness, and overall skin quality. Hydration supports barrier function throughout retinol's adjustment period while retinol's collagen-stimulating effects build on a well-maintained moisture balance.

 

Skin Type Considerations: Who Benefits Most

Different skin types respond differently to hydration and active repair ingredients, requiring tailored approaches that address specific vulnerabilities and needs.

  • Sensitive & Reactive Skin: Start with the best retinol for sensitive skin at 0.25-0.3% concentration, using the sandwich method. Combining retinol with bakuchiol, niacinamide, or DNA repair enzymes significantly improves tolerance while maintaining efficacy alongside hyaluronic acid's gentle barrier-strengthening hydration.
  • Dry & Dehydrated Skin: Layer hyaluronic acid under rich moisturizers to buffer retinol's drying effects. Begin with 2 to 3 weekly applications, prioritizing barrier repair before increasing frequency as tolerance builds.
  • Mature & Sun-Damaged Skin: Combine hydration with active collagen repair for best results. Frequently Asked Questions About How Hyaluronic Acid Compares To Retinol For Anti-Aging

Can someone with sensitive skin use retinol without experiencing irritation or redness?

Yes, with proper introduction and formulation selection. Start with 0.25-0.3% encapsulated retinol 2-3 times weekly, use the sandwich method with moisturizers, and choose formulations with soothing ingredients like bakuchiol or niacinamide.

 

Should I apply hyaluronic acid before or after retinol in my skincare routine?

Apply hyaluronic acid first on damp skin to maximize hydration, then wait until skin is completely dry before applying retinol. This sequence provides moisture support while preventing excessive retinol penetration, which can increase irritation.

 

Why does my skin feel dry when using retinol if I'm also using hyaluronic acid?

Retinol increases cellular turnover and can temporarily compromise barrier function during adjustment, creating dryness that exceeds hyaluronic acid's hydration capacity. Add heavier moisturizers and consider buffering retinol until tolerance improves.

 

Does hyaluronic acid prevent collagen loss, or does it only fill in fine lines temporarily?

Hyaluronic acid only provides temporary surface plumping and doesn't prevent collagen degradation. It supports barrier function, which indirectly helps maintain skin health, but doesn't stimulate collagen production or prevent structural aging.

Is it better to start with hyaluronic acid or retinol when beginning an anti-aging routine?

Start with hyaluronic acid for 2-4 weeks to establish barrier stability and hydration, then gradually introduce retinol. This sequence creates the supportive foundation necessary for comfortable retinoid tolerance and reduces adjustment-period irritation.
